The tenth generation of the Ford Thunderbird is a front-engine, rear-drive, five passenger, two-door personal luxury coupe manufactured and marketed by Ford for the 1989 to 1997 model years. Introduced on December 26, 1988 as a 1989 model, the Thunderbird was co-developed with the Mercury Cougar. using Ford's new MN12 platform — with a more aerodynamic body, slightly shorter overall length and nine-inch-longer wheelbase than the outgoing 1988 Thunderbird.
